Motion Capture Systems - [eMove]

Following are eMove objectives

  • Real-time Animation streaming from eMove motion capture suit to gaming engines such as Panda3D, Unity3D, UnReal, Blender 3D and Scientific simulation software such as Siemens Jack software.
  • Design and implementation of Infrastructure for Massively Multiplayer Online Games (MMOG) connected with eMove motion capture suit, where the users from different areas wearing eMove suit can play 3D real-time games and virtual meetings.
  • Audio, video, Animation and text data over UDP in real time on wide area networks (i.e. Virtual Private Networks based on Internet) for Motion capture application (eMove) and technology enhanced learning environments with Digital heritage libraries (DISPLAYS).
  • As a part of eMove project I am working different Lip-Sync and Animation technologies like: Motion Builder and Blender 3D that accepts BVH (Bio-Vision Hierarchy data) from a remote machine and feed it to a 3D avatar.

High performance computing environments 

Implementation of Grid based Render Farm solution at no cost for Blender 3D, 3Ds Max, and Maya, by utilizing idle computer cycles (CPU Scavenging) and discarded computer systems (Green use of computing).

  • A complete Render farm management system for Blender 3D that can be deployed inside blender as a toolbar.
  • Render farm solution for 3Ds Max that can be deployed in digital heritage applications and other applications that required collaborative modeling and rendering.
  • Render farm solution for Maya 3D that can be used in collaborative modeling environments.

PhD  - Digital heritage systems, Motion capture systems and Grid computing

Applying new technologies such as power of Grid computing (Grid based Render farms), top interaction technology like exo-skeleton based motion capture suits (eMove), and Audio, Video and text based communications (eMove Chat systems) inside digital heritage environment to facilitate both 3D modelers - the designers of digital heritage and remote visitors of virtual museums to build interactive digital heritage community. This framework coupled with example results will allow the end users to navigate through digital heritage world and interact with heritage objects. There can be number of benefits including virtual heritage tours, simmulations, real-time online multiplayer games and Massively Multiplayer Online Games - MMOGs, virtual meetings, collaborations, conferences, etc...

A propsed Service Oriented Architectures in preservation of heritage resources, allowing contents and knowledge to be produced, stored, managed, personalized, transmitted, preserved and used reliably, efficiently, at low cost and according to widely accepted standards. Currently, working on deploying such type of architecture and infrastructure for an ongoing project DISPLAYS - (Digital Library Service for Playing with virtual heritage objects) in Center for VLSI and Computer Graphics.
